From 0bf86ef7b8f0ecad958f3fb592ceaf3d2f30336a Mon Sep 17 00:00:00 2001 From: iamcheeseman <[hidden email]> Date: Tue, 13 Jan 2026 22:28:59 -0500 Subject: add support for tiled objects --- src/player.odin | 12 ++++++++++++ 1 file changed, 12 insertions(+) (limited to 'src/player.odin') diff --git a/src/player.odin b/src/player.odin index 71b015b..f2afd6c 100644 --- a/src/player.odin +++ b/src/player.odin @@ -218,3 +218,15 @@ update_player :: proc(dt: f32) { draw_player :: proc() { draw_sprite(player.sprite) } + +@(private = "file") +already_spawned_player := false + +player_spawn_object_spawner :: proc(obj: Object_Resource) { + if already_spawned_player { + return + } + already_spawned_player = true + + phys.set_body_position(player.body_handle, obj.pos) +} -- cgit v1.3-2-g0d8e